Act Info:
[THE FIRST SCHEDULE]
[See sections 2 and 5(1).]
Item No. | Injury | Percentage of disability |
1 | Loss of two or more limbs. | 100 |
Lunacy. | ||
Jacksonian epilepsy. | ||
Very severe facial disfigurement. | ||
2 | Loss of right arm above or at the elbow. | 90 |
3 | Severe facial disfigurement. | 70 |
Total loss of speech. | ||
Loss of left arm above or at the elbow. | ||
Loss of right arm below the elbow. | ||
Loss of leg at or above the knee. | ||
4 | Loss of left arm below the elbow. | 60 |
Loss of leg below the knee. | ||
Permanent total loss of hearing. | ||
5 | Loss of one eye. | 50 |
Loss of right thumb or four fingers of right hand. | ||
6 | Loss of all toes of both feet above knuckle. | 40 |
Loss of left thumb or four fingers of left | ||
hand or three fingers of right hand. | ||
7 | Loss of all toes of one foot above knuckle. | 30 |
Loss of all toes of both feet at or below knuckle. | ||
8 | Limited restriction of movement of joints through | 20 |
injury without penetration, limited function of | ||
limb through fracture. | ||
Loss of two fingers of either hand. | ||
Compound fracture of thumb or two or more | ||
fingers of either hand with impaired function. | ||
9 | Loss of one phalanx of thumb. | 10 |
Loss of index finger. | ||
Loss of great toe. |
